Enhancing Engineering Computer-Aided Design Education Using Lectures Recorded on the PC
McGrann, Roy T. R.
Journal of Educational Technology Systems, v34 n2 p165-175 2005-2006
Computer-Aided Engineering (CAE) is a course that is required during the third year in the mechanical engineering curriculum at Binghamton University. The primary objective of the course is to educate students in the procedures of computer-aided engineering design. The solid modeling and analysis program Pro/Engineer[TM] (PTC[R]) is used as the basis of this course. As a means to this objective, students must be trained to use the Pro/Engineer[TM] software. We created a series of video lectures using Camtasia Studio (TechSmith[R]) to accomplish the Pro/Engineer[TM] training. As the literature for the software says: "Camtasia Studio is a complete solution for quickly creating professional-looking videos of your PC desktop activity." Thirteen videos were created for this course, which incorporated audio combined with PowerPoint[TM] slides. The video files (avi's) are distributed to students on five CD's. This article describes the structure of the course and how the videos are integrated into it. Also included is a brief overview of the creation of the videos. Results of a survey of student satisfaction with the video format that was used in the course are presented. (Contains 10 footnotes, 2 figures and 3 tables.)
